Release 3.14.2 #1467
Stranger6667
started this conversation in
General
Release 3.14.2
#1467
Replies: 0 comments
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
🎉 Schemathesis.io: schema-based API testing as a service. 🎉
This release adds support for Schemathesis.io - you can upload your test results and visualize them.
Or, you can signup to a Pro account and use our servers to run enhanced tests against your API.
Feel free to join our Discord - we'd love to hear your feedback!
🚀 CLI features
#966
_name
argument toschema.add_link
.st
as an alias to theschemathesis
command line entrypoint.st auth login
/st auth logout
to authenticate with Schemathesis.io.X-Schemathesis-TestCaseId
header to help to distinguish test cases on the application side. [FEATURE] Generate headers for debugging #1303--checks
CLI option. [FEATURE] Support comma separated list for--checks
#1373--hypothesis-database
option. [FEATURE] Configure Hypothesis DB via CLI #1326SCHEMA
CLI argument accept API slugs from Schemathesis.io.🐛 Bug fixes
@schema.parametrize
with test methods onpytest>=7.0
.source
attribute in theCase.partial_deepcopy
implementation. [BUG]Case.source
is not copied insidepartial_deepcopy
#1429content_type_conformance
andresponse_schema_conformance
checks when the checked response has noContent-Type
header. [BUG] "Content-Type missing" message might be duplicated by multiple checks #1394case
&response
insideCase.validate_response
.pytest.mark
decorators when they are applied beforeschema.parametrize
if the schema is created viafrom_pytest_fixture
. [BUG] schema decorator does not play nice with pytest marks #1378🔧 Chores and Improvements
--stateful=none
.--validate-schema=true
.api_slug
CLI argument to upload data to Schemathesis.io./foo}/
). Improve an error on malformed path templates #1372pyyaml
andclick
.--cassette-path
that is going to replace--store-network-log
. The old option is deprecated and will be removed in Schemathesis4.0
P.S. These release notes contain entries from multiple releases, as they were not properly displayed on GitHub before
This discussion was created from the release Release 3.14.2.
Beta Was this translation helpful? Give feedback.
All reactions